Introduction to Red Food Coloring

Red food coloring, like other artificial colorings, is synthesized from chemicals. The most common red food colorings are Red 40 (Allura Red) and Red 3 (Erythrosine), each with its own set of applications and controversies. Red 40 is one of the most widely used artificial food colorings and is known for its vibrant red color. It is used in a variety of food products, including candies, fruit juices, and cosmetics. On the other hand, Red 3 is often used in food products like cherries, fruit Cocktails, and candy.

Factors Influencing the Shelf Life of Red Food Coloring

Several factors can influence the shelf life of red food coloring, including:

  • Light Exposure: Direct sunlight and artificial lighting can cause the colors to fade or degrade over time.
  • Temperature: High temperatures can accelerate chemical reactions that lead to the breakdown of the coloring.
  • Moisture: Water can react with the coloring, leading to changes in its composition and effectiveness.
  • Oxygen Exposure: Similar to moisture, oxygen can contribute to the degradation of the coloring, especially in the presence of light or heat.

Safety and Regulatory Standards

The safety of red food coloring is a topic of ongoing debate. While regulatory bodies like the FDA in the United States and the EFSA in Europe have approved these colorings for use in food products, there are concerns about their potential health impacts. Some studies have suggested links between certain artificial colorings and hyperactivity in children, though the evidence is not conclusive. As a result, many manufacturers are opting for natural alternatives to artificial colorings, despite the higher costs and potential variability in color intensity.

Regulatory Approval and Compliance

For a food coloring to be approved for use, it must undergo rigorous testing to ensure its safety for human consumption. This includes toxicity studies, exposure assessments, and evaluations of its potential to cause allergic reactions. The regulatory approval process is stringent, with ongoing monitoring of approved colorings to ensure they continue to meet safety standards.

International Variations in Regulation

It’s worth noting that regulatory standards for food colorings can vary significantly from one country to another. While Red 40, for example, is widely approved, its acceptable daily intake (ADI) may differ between the U.S. and Europe. Moreover, some countries have banned certain artificial colorings due to health concerns, leading to a complex global regulatory landscape for food manufacturers.

Alternatives to Artificial Red Food Coloring

Given the concerns surrounding artificial colorings, many consumers and manufacturers are turning to natural alternatives. These can include beet juice, pomegranate, and other fruit or vegetable extracts that provide a range of red shades. While these alternatives can offer a safer and more natural option, they also present challenges in terms of color consistency, cost, and stability.

Natural Colorings and Their Challenges

Natural colorings, despite their advantages, have their own set of challenges. These include variability in color intensity, potential for allergic reactions, and higher production costs compared to artificial colorings. Moreover, achieving consistent color shades with natural products can be difficult, which may impact product appearance and consumer acceptance.

What is the shelf life of red food coloring?

The shelf life of red food coloring can vary depending on the type and brand of the product, as well as how it is stored. Generally, artificial food colorings like red food coloring have a long shelf life when stored properly in a cool, dry place, away from direct sunlight and heat sources. Most manufacturers recommend using their products within two to three years of opening, but this can vary. It’s also important to check the expiration date or “best by” date on the packaging to ensure you’re using the product within the recommended timeframe.

To extend the shelf life of red food coloring, it’s essential to store it in an airtight container and keep it away from moisture, heat, and light. If the coloring is exposed to these elements, it can break down and lose its potency, leading to uneven or faded color. Additionally, if you notice any changes in the color, consistency, or smell of the product, it’s best to err on the side of caution and discard it. Always check the product for visible signs of spoilage, such as mold or sediment, before using it. If in doubt, it’s better to purchase a fresh bottle of red food coloring to ensure the best possible results in your recipes.

How can I tell if my red food coloring has gone bad?

To determine if your red food coloring has gone bad, you should inspect the product for visible signs of spoilage. Check the coloring for any changes in color, consistency, or smell. If the product has an off smell, a slimy texture, or has developed mold, it’s likely gone bad and should be discarded. You should also check the packaging for any signs of damage, such as cracks, dents, or rust, which can compromise the quality and safety of the product. If the product is past its expiration date or shows any visible signs of deterioration, it’s best to err on the side of caution and replace it with a fresh bottle.

In addition to visible signs of spoilage, you can also perform a simple test to determine if your red food coloring is still effective. Mix a small amount of the coloring with water or another liquid and observe the color. If the color is uneven, faded, or doesn’t mix well with the liquid, it may be a sign that the product has broken down and lost its potency. If this is the case, it’s best to purchase a new bottle of red food coloring to ensure the best possible results in your recipes. How do I store red food coloring to extend its shelf life?

To extend the shelf life of red food coloring, it’s essential to store it properly. The product should be kept in an airtight container, such as the original packaging or a glass jar with a tight-fitting lid. The container should be stored in a cool, dry place, away from direct sunlight and heat sources. Avoid storing the product near a window, oven, or stove, as the heat and light can cause the coloring to break down and lose its potency.

In addition to storing the product in an airtight container, you should also keep it away from moisture and humidity. If the product is exposed to moisture, it can become contaminated with bacteria or mold, which can pose a risk to food safety. To prevent this, make sure the container is clean and dry before storing the product, and avoid touching the product or the container with your hands or any utensils that may have come into contact with moisture. By storing red food coloring properly, you can help extend its shelf life and ensure it remains effective and safe to use in your recipes.
